Sad Time

It's a sad time during a time that it should be joyous. The holidays should be a joyous time. Well, on Wednesday December 30, 2009 Canada suffered a loss of 4 soldiers and one Canadian reporter in Afghanistan. Michelle Lang was the first Canadian reporter to be killed.

It was found out that one of the soldiers killed is one from my area. This war in Afghanistan has been going on for so long and I guess it was inevitable that we lose someone from our little part of the world. It is such a rural area that you wouldn't think that the war would really hit home.

Well, it did. Sergent Kirk Taylor was born in Shelburne and lived in Yarmouth the past few years. Although I personally didn't know him, I still feel the loss as if I did know him.
